Laura grew up on the pioneering frontier. She loved the big woods of Wisconsin but during her childhood she would move to the vast prairies of Dakota. Pa had moved to Dakota Territory to homestead. In 1862, the government passed the Homestead Act. This allowed a person to claim 160 acres of land and if they could live on the land for 5 years and farm 10 acres of the land, the government would give them the land. It was called “Free Land”. In reality, the struggle of living on the untamed prairies proved to be a challenge.
